Iran's Bush vs Gore
Michael Roston:
I expect that Ahmadinejad’s margin of victory will shrink. If the vote
wasn’t closer than it appears according to state-led media’s
projections, the reformist ex-mayor of Tehran, Gholamhossein Karbaschi,
probably would not be meeting with the Supreme Leader, as TehranBureau
reports from his Farsi-language Twitter feed. Something is being
brokered to contain the anger of the massive number of voters who
turned out to cast votes for reformist Mirhossein Mousavi. And you can
see another official lowering expectations of Ahmadinejad’s margin of
victory from the high 60s to a much lower number in this AFP story.
